China Chow is a British actress and model. Her roles include the films The Big Hit , Head Over Heels (2001), Spun , Sol Goode , and SPF-18 ; the made-for-tv movie Frankenfish ; the video game Grand Theft Auto: San Andreas ; and the shows That ’70s Show and Burn Notice .

She is the daughter of Tina Chow (born Bettina Louise Lutz) and Michael Chow. Her father is the owner of restaurant chain Mr Chow; he was born in Shanghai, China, to Zhou Xinfang, a famous actor, and Lilian Qiu, from a wealthy family. He is of Chinese and one eighth Scottish descent.

China’s mother, a model, jewelry designer, and influential fashion icon, was born in Lakeview, Ohio, to a German-American father, Walter Edmund Lutz, and a Japanese mother, Mona Furuki. The couple met in Japan while Walter served in the American military. China’s mother, Tina, died of AIDS at the age of 41, as a result of an extramarital affair with French aristocrat Kim D’Estainvillle.

China has a brother, Max, who is three years younger. Her aunt is Chinese actress, singer, director, teacher, and former “Bond girl” Tsai Chin.

China’s paternal grandmother was named Qiu Lilin. Qiu was of three quarters Chinese and one quarter Scottish descent.

China’s maternal grandfather was Walter Edmund Lutz (the son of Ferdinand Carl Lutz and Lydia Anna Catherine Weseloh). Walter was born in Ohio. Ferdinand was born in Ohio, the son of German parents, Carl Paul Edmund Lutz and Augusta L. Schultz. Lydia was born in Ohio, to a German-born father, The Rev. Heinrich/Henry Johann/John Weseloh, a Lutheran minister, and to a mother, Fannie Marie Rastede/Scheer, who was born in Illinois, to German parents.

China’s maternal grandmother is named Mona Miwako Furuki.
